当前位置: 首页> 函数类别大全> bcdiv

bcdiv

2个任意精度的数字除法计算
名称:bcdiv
分类:BCMath
所属语言:php
一句话介绍:2个任意精度的数字除法计算

bcdiv 函数

适用 PHP 版本

PHP 5.0.0 及以上版本。

函数说明

bcdiv 函数用于精确地除法运算,处理任意精度的数字。它将一个数字除以另一个数字,并返回一个高精度的结果。

函数语法

bcdiv( dividend, divisor, scale )

参数

  • dividend (必需) - 被除数,作为字符串传入。
  • divisor (必需) - 除数,作为字符串传入。
  • scale (可选) - 结果的小数位数。默认值为 0,表示返回整数。

返回值

返回一个字符串类型的结果,表示两数相除后的精确结果。

示例

以下是 bcdiv 函数的一个示例:

示例代码

<?php
// 示例:精确除法,保留 2 位小数
$num1 = "10";
$num2 = "3";
$result = bcdiv($num1, $num2, 2);
echo $result; // 输出 3.33
?>

示例代码说明

在该示例中,bcdiv 函数用于计算 10 除以 3 的结果,并指定保留 2 位小数。因此输出结果为 3.33。参数中,$num1 和 $num2 分别为被除数和除数,而 2 是表示保留小数的位数。

同类函数
  • 任意精度数字的乘方 bcpow

    bcpow

    任意精度数字的乘方
  • 任意精度数字的二次方根 bcsqrt

    bcsqrt

    任意精度数字的二次方根
  • 2个任意精度数字乘法计算 bcmul

    bcmul

    2个任意精度数字乘法计算
  • 2个任意精度数字的减法 bcsub

    bcsub

    2个任意精度数字的减法
  • 任意精度数字的乘方,再取模 bcpowmod

    bcpowmod

    任意精度数字的乘方,再取模
  • 2个任意精度数字的加法计算 bcadd

    bcadd

    2个任意精度数字的加法计算
  • 对一个任意精度数字取模 bcmod

    bcmod

    对一个任意精度数字取模
  • 设置所有bc数学函数的默认小数点保留位数 bcscale

    bcscale

    设置所有bc数学函数的默认小数点保留位数
热门文章